Best Times to Visit Asanamihara

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the optimal time to visit this destination ensures you experience its unique charm at its best, whether you prefer the vibrant atmosphere or a more tranquil retreat in the region.

Peak Season Highlights

spring
Spring (March to May)

During spring, the area blooms with cherry blossoms, making it an ideal time for sightseeing and outdoor activities in this Japanese destination.

Average Temperature Daytime: 15-20°C - Nighttime: 8-12°C
autumn
Autumn (September to November)

Autumn offers vibrant foliage and mild weather, perfect for exploring the region's scenic beauty and local culture.

Average Temperature Daytime: 17-22°C - Nighttime: 10-15°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Summer (June to August)

Summers can be humid and hot, but this is a quieter time to enjoy the area's natural serenity away from peak crowds.

Average Temperature Daytime: 25-30°C - Nighttime: 20-24°C
image
Winter (December to February)

Winter sees cooler temperatures and less tourist activity, providing an opportunity for peaceful retreats in cozy accommodations.

Average Temperature Daytime: 7-10°C - Nighttime: 2-5°C

Local Customs Options

  • Respect for Tradition: You will notice a strong emphasis on honoring longstanding customs, such as the careful observance of seasonal festivals and ceremonies that are integral to local life here.
  • Bathing Etiquette in Onsen: When experiencing the hot springs, it’s customary to thoroughly wash before entering the communal baths and to keep modesty by following specific bathing manners prevalent in this region.
  • Gift-Giving Customs: If you participate in local exchanges, giving small, thoughtful gifts is appreciated and often accompanied by polite bowing and respectful gestures.
  • Greetings and Politeness: Bowing as a sign of respect is common when greeting residents or participating in community activities in this part of Japan, reflecting the area's courteous cultural norms.
